The Oscar nominated Irish animators Brown Bag Films are looking to fill 71 new jobs

2016 has been a stellar year for the Irish film industry as seen by the sleuth of Oscar nominations that Irish talent received, but one of the trailblazers in the animation industry are currently looking for new talent.

Digital animation company Brown Bag Films are creating 71 jobs over the next two years and they’re looking for staff. At present, Brown Bag employs 184 creative and production staff, spread across their Dublin headquarters, Manchester studio and LA office.

The talented animators have already won 14 Emmy awards and received two Oscar nominations for Give Up Your Aul Sins and Granny O’Grimm’s Sleeping Beauty.

In terms of what the company is currently producing, they’re the minds behind the children’s TV shows Octonauts, Doc McStuffins, Peter Rabbit, Henry Hugglemonster and Bing, The company is also working on a computer generated adaptation of Richard Adams novel Watership Down for Netflix and BBC.

Brown Bag was founded 22 years ago by Cathal Gaffney and Darragh O’Connell.
